University libraries and digital presence: guidelines for the use of social media

ABSTRACT

This article presents guidelines of use of social media by librarians in university libraries. It argues the context of the contemporary society, strongly marked by the digital information. It reflects also on the role of the university library applying the concept of digital presence in this context. It argues the profile of librarian while actor in the process of insertion of the university library in the digital context. It presents resulted of investigation made in the universe of university libraries of college public institutions in Brazil. The methodological route was traced by an exploratory, documentary and bibliographical investigation with content analysis applied to documents found. Data were collected through bibliographic and documentary research, and survey in 40 sites of international institutions. The article concludes by presenting seven guidelines for the use of social media in university libraries in order to foster a more effective and relevant digital presence.
